Pricing Dynamics: Mobile vs. PC
When discussing platforms, the issue of pricing inevitably surfaces. Below is a comparative table to showcase the typical price ranges associated with both genres:
| Platform | Typical Price Range | Notable Titles |
|---|---|---|
| Mobile Games | $0 - $40 | Clash of Clans, Candy Crush |
| PC Games | $10 - $70+ | EA Sports FC 24, Delta Force Hawk Ops |
As seen from the table, mobile games often come at a much more favorable price point, making them accessible to a wider audience, while PC games offer a premium experience for those willing to invest.

Future Trends: What Lies Ahead?
As we venture into the future, one question remains: How will mobile and PC evolve to entice gamers further? The intersection of technology and creativity promises endless possibilities. For instance, cloud gaming can open new doors, allowing games to be played seamlessly across devices—bridging the gap between mobile and PC.
